Highlights
Are people in St. Louis older or younger than people in Troy?
- The Median Age in St. Louis is 1.6 years younger than in Troy.

Are housing costs cheaper in St. Louis or Troy?
- St. Louis housing costs are 38.9% less expensive than Troy housing costs.

Which city has a longer commute, St. Louis or Troy?
- The average commute for residents of St. Louis is 1.8 minutes shorter than it is for residents of Troy.

Things to do in St. Louis?
St. Louis, Missouri is an eclectic city full of attractions for all tastes. Visitors can explore the iconic Gateway Arch or take a stroll along the historic cobblestone streets of Laclede’s Landing. Culture enthusiasts can visit the St. Louis Art Museum and get a glimpse into the city's vibrant history at the Missouri History Museum. Sports fans can enjoy a game at Enterprise Center or head to Busch Stadium and cheer on their favorite baseball team. Nature lovers will appreciate exploring Forest Park or visiting Citygarden Sculpture Park in downtown. After dark, there’s plenty of pubs, clubs and restaurants offering everything from craft beer to authentic Cajun meals – perfect for a night out! With its diverse attractions, St. Louis offers something for everyone!
